| | | adjudicate  | | verb | uh-JOO-dih-kayt |
| | Definition | | 1 : | to make an official decision about who is right in (a dispute) : to settle judicially | 2 : | |

TAKE ME THERE  | | | | Did You Know? | | Adjudicate is one of several terms that give testimony to the influence of jus, the Latin word for "law," on our legal language. Adjudicate is from the Latin verb adjudicare, from judicare, meaning "to judge," which, in turn, traces to the Latin noun judex, meaning "judge." English has other judex words, such as judgment, judicial, judiciary, and prejudice. If we admit further evidence, we discover that the root of judex is jus. What's the verdict? Latin "law" words frequently preside in English-speaking courtrooms. In addition to the judex words, jury, justice, injury, and perjury are all ultimately from Latin jus. | | | | Examples of ADJUDICATE | | "… Nichols said in addition to the nine dogs brought to the shelter, it is housing 31 dogs that were confiscated in animal cruelty or neglect cases.
